Patent Grant D646221

U.S. patent number D646,221 [Application Number D/343,983] was granted by the patent office on 2011-10-04 for tread portion of an automobile tire. This patent grant is currently assigned to Bridgestone Corporation. Invention is credited to Yukihiro Kiwaki.

Description



FIG. 1 is a front view of a tread portion of an automobile tire according to the present invention;

FIG. 2 is a perspective view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a rear view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a left side view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a right side view thereof; and,

FIG. 6 is a fragmentary enlarged view showing the details of the tread portion thereof.

Broken lines in the drawing figures are intended to show environmental structure only, and form no part of the claimed design.
